Key Responsibilities:
- Oversee banquet kitchen operations for events ranging from intimate dinners to 1000+ guest celebrations
- Lead and manage a dedicated team of 12 culinary professionals, fostering excellence, accountability, and growth
- Execute menus using RATIONAL cooking systems with precision and consistency
- Collaborate on seasonal menu development and experiential food stations
- Maintain accurate food costing and forecasting using Profit Sword and other financial tools
- Drive operational efficiency through Hotel Effectiveness and proactive prep, staffing, and service execution
- Ensure compliance with health, safety, and sanitation standards
- Partner with event managers to ensure seamless guest experiences from prep to plate
- Maintain food service/ guest satisfaction scores
- Minimum 5 years of banquet or high-volume catering experience
- Proficiency with RATIONAL Cooking Sytems, Profit Sword, Hotel Effectiveness, and Microsoft Office Suite
- Proven ability to manage and motivate a team of 12 in a fast-paced environment
- Exceptional organizational and time-management skills
- Calm, creative leadership under pressure
- Passion for hospitality, teamwork, and culinary innovation
